Versant Capital Management's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Versant Capital Management held 2,859 positions worth $1.01B, up 27% from $797M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Versant Capital Management deployed $212M of net new capital in Q1 2026, opening 220 new positions and adding to 1,610 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F: 120,588 shares worth $8.41M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was VanEck Gold Miners ETF, an estimated $1.27M trimmed.
